2.  Method 1475 universities  (cited times in top 1% indexed by ESI in recent 11 years ) 2413 research institutions  (cited times in top 1% indexed by ESI ) 22  subject s   (ESI) Data  Sources Index System World-class Universities and Subject s Object
2.  Method ESI  Essential Science Indicators 1998.1.1 – 2008.12.31 DII  Derwent Patents of Thomson Scientific Group Citation Index Innovation 2004 -2008 Object Index  System World-class Universities and Subject s Data  Sources
2.  Method Data combining A institution with different names Universities and research institutions Index System World-class Universities and   Subject s Object Data  Sources
2.  Method The patent data of Chemistry, Electronics and Engineering is included in the discipline s  of Chemistry, Physics and Engineering in ESI respectively.  Object Index System World-class Universities and Subject s Data  Sources
2.3 Index System High-cited papers   refer to the papers in a certain subject and certain time whose cited times in top 1% Hot papers  refer to the papers published in recent two years whose cited times in top 0.1% in recent two months  Indicators

Table 1  Index system to evaluate the research competitiveness  of world-class universities 2.3 Index System First-level Indicator Second-level Indicator Weight Scientific Productivity Number of Published Papers 30% Scientific Impact Number of Total Cited Times 20% Number of Highly Cited Papers 20% Number of Subjects Indexed by ESI 5% Scientific Innovation Number of Patents 5% Number of Hot Papers 10% Scientific Potential Ratio of Highly Cited Papers 10%
Table 2  Index system to evaluate 22 subject s  competitiveness of world-class universities and research institutions 2.3 Index   System First-level Indicator Second-level Indicator Weight Scientific Productivity Number of Published Papers 30% Scientific Impact Number of Total Cited Times 25% Number of Highly Cited Papers 20% Scientific Innovation Number of Patents 5% Number of Hot Papers 10% Scientific Potential Ratio of Highly Cited Papers 10%

Method High-level university 1475 universities in the world   - Top 600 (top 0.5%)  Three grades  : -  Top universities : top 100 universities  -  Famous universities :  top 101 - 300  -  Well-known universities :  top 301 - 600  Object Data  Sources Index  System World-class Universities and Subject s
2.  Method World-class subject Top 10% in a certain subject  Three grades:  - Top subject: top 1%  - Famous subject:  top 1%  -  5% - Well-known subject:  top 5% - 10%   Object Data  Sources Index  System World-class Universities and Subject s

4. Results Analysis (1) The remarkable improvement of overall scientific research strength of China Chinese Mainland  - Ranks 12th  Hong Kong   - Ranks 22nd Taiwan  - Ranks 26th
4. Results Analysis (2) The large gap between Chinese universities and the world-class universities Chinese universities   -Top 100:  0  -Top 200:  3 -Top 400:  7 -Top 600:  20 -After Top 600:  majority
4. Results Analysis (3) The large gap of  high-quality papers number as well as the world scientific research strength between our country and others Chinese mainland -High cited papers:  11th -Hot  papers:  11th
4. Results Analysis Gaps - World -class scientists  - Nobel Prize winners  - High quality papers  - World class achievements - Hot papers
4. Results Analysis (4) The great distance of research innovation between China and the top countries China Patent: 3rd (1/5 of the United States and 1/3 of Japan) Hot paper:11th Invention patent: China : Only 11%  Top countries: nearly 90%
4. Results Analysis (5) Vigorously strengthen the construction of top subjects Peking University :  12 Zhejiang University :  11 Tsinghua University :  8 Fudan University :  8 Nanjing University:  7 Chinese Academy of Sciences :  19
